About this home
Discover one of Lake Norman’s best-kept secrets and enjoy beautiful lake views from this third-floor condo. This is a rare opportunity to own a lakefront condo priced under $500,000 with a deeded boat slip just steps away.
The bright, open floor plan features engineered hardwood flooring in the foyer and kitchen, crown molding throughout, custom window treatments, and ceiling fans in every room and on the terrace. The unit also offers excellent attic storage.
Step outside to the peaceful terrace overlooking the marina and Lake Norman. Enjoy resort-style community amenities, including a large in-ground pool overlooking the lake, tennis courts, a sandy beach, and a common recreation area. Start enjoying the Lake Life with spectacular water views, convenient boating access, and plenty of space to relax and entertain.

About Denver
Lake Norman west · Rural growth
Lincoln County town on the west side of Lake Norman — fastest-growing rural market in the region, with new subdivisions tied to the lake and the Highway 16 corridor.
